Garchomp reappeared in ''[[BW085|All for the Love of Meloetta!]]'' where she battled [[Iris's Axew]]. Axew's {{m|Scratch}} and {{m|Dragon Rage}} successfully hit Garchomp but seemed to do no damage. Garchomp then used her Dragon Rush and Draco Meteor attacks to cause a lot of damage to Axew. At the last second when it seemed like Axew was down, he got back up and ended up knocking Garchomp down with his newly learned Giga Impact and shocking everybody. Garchomp quickly recovered and was about to finish Axew off with a Brick Break but was called off by Cynthia at the last second.

Garchomp appeared again in [[BW090]] where she battled [[Caitlin]]'s {{p|Gothitelle}} in an exhibition match for the [[Pokémon World Tournament Junior Cup]]. After being confused by {{m|Flatter}}, Garchomp was lifted high into the air by Gothitelle's {{m|Psychic}}. Garchomp overcame the confusion and used the top of the stadium to launch herself forward and hit her opponent with Dragon Rush. After Garchomp's Draco Meteor was stopped by Gothitelle's {{m|Thunderbolt}} and both their Brick Break attacks clashed, the battle's 10 minute time limit ran out, and the match was named a tie.
